The Meaning Behind Water Lily Tattoos
The water lily is admired for its ability to bloom beautifully while floating peacefully on still waters.
A water lily tattoo commonly symbolizes:
- Purity and inner peace
- Personal growth
- Renewal and transformation
- Harmony with nature
- Resilience through challenges
- Emotional balance
Much like the lotus, the water lily reminds us that beauty can emerge even from difficult circumstances.
Why Combine a Flower with a Stamp?
A stamp tattoo represents memories, travel, exploration, and meaningful moments frozen in time.
When combined with a flower, the design becomes a symbolic postcard from a chapter of life. Many people choose stamp tattoos to represent:
- A memorable trip
- A meaningful destination
- A life-changing experience
- Cultural appreciation
- Personal milestones
For visitors to Vietnam, a floral stamp tattoo can serve as a lasting reminder of their journey.
Color Brings the Flower to Life
The addition of vibrant color transforms the design into a miniature artwork.
Soft pinks, blues, purples, or reds can highlight the natural beauty of the water lily while creating contrast against the structured frame of the stamp. The combination of bold color and clean borders creates a striking visual balance between nature and graphic design.
